Key Responsibilities

The Clinical Development Lead is the clinical and scientific expert responsible for leading the delivery of clinical program objectives for an assigned compound, in line with Company strategy and agreed development plans.

Main responsibilities include:

• Lead the multidisciplinary Clinical Team at development-program level, providing scientific direction, strategic alignment and accountability across the program. • Shape innovative clinical development strategies that maximize the compound's value throughout its lifecycle, integrating emerging scientific evidence and evolving standard of care into development plans. • Lead the scientific development and delivery of clinical sections of trial- and program-level regulatory documents, including Investigator’s Brochures, briefing books, safety updates, submission dossiers and responses to Health Authorities. • Provide thought leadership in clinical trial design and execution in close partnership with key functions, ensuring scientific quality, clear prioritisation and timely delivery. • Provide ongoing clinical and scientific review, interpretation and communication of clinical trial data to inform program strategy and development decisions. • Serve as a core member of the Safety Management Team and contribute to the assessment and communication of the compound’s benefit-risk profile. • Support the preparation of safety-related documents, including Periodic Safety Update Reports, Drug Safety Update Reports and other safety documentation, in collaboration with the Project Physician and Drug Safety Physician. • Maintain a strong understanding of the therapeutic area, competitive landscape, relevant mechanisms of action and evolving standards of care. • Lead clinical contributions to scientific communications, including study abstracts, posters, oral presentations and manuscripts. • Represent the Company as a credible scientific leader externally with investigators, scientific experts, advisory boards and Health Authorities. • Champion the clinical perspective in cross-functional discussions and support the continuous evolution of the clinical development strategy.

Candidate Requirements

• Advanced degree in life or health sciences, such as PhD, MD, PharmD, MSc or equivalent. • At least eight years of relevant experience in clinical development within the pharmaceutical or biotechnology industry. • Proven experience leading Phase II to IV clinical development programs in global, cross-functional matrix environments through successful planning, delivery and publication. • Strong experience supporting global regulatory submissions and Health Authority interactions, including the preparation of key clinical and regulatory documents throughout the development lifecycle. • Excellent understanding of global drug development and innovative clinical trial design through all phases, with the ability to integrate preclinical, translational, clinical, and real-world evidence to inform development strategies; pediatric development experience is an advantage. • Intellectually curious with strong scientific acumen, entrepreneurial spirit, and learning agility, with the ability to challenge conventional thinking constructively. • Excellent written and verbal communication skills, with strong executive presence and the ability to effectively communicate complex scientific concepts to diverse internal and external stakeholders • Strong project management, prioritization, problem-solving and stakeholder-management capabilities. • Ability to work independently, influence decision-making and build alignment across cross-functional teams in a dynamic matrix organization. • A collaborative, proactive and pragmatic mindset, with a strong sense of ownership and commitment to delivering high-quality clinical evidence.
